Who says there’s not 205 hours in a day?
The federal Medicare Fraud Strike Force obtained indictments of 243 people in June in alleged scams and swindles. Among those arrested was Dr. Noble U. Ezukanma, 56, of Fort Worth, Texas, who billed the government for working 205 hours in a single day. Other indictees were similarly accused of inflating the work they did for Medicare patients, but Ezukanma had the most productive day of all.
